Key Moments and Achievements
Let's quickly recap some of the defining moments:
- The "We Believe" Upset (2007): Remember when Baron Davis and company shocked the top-seeded Dallas Mavericks? That underdog spirit set the tone for future success.
- The Rise of Steph and Klay: The emergence of Stephen Curry and Klay Thompson as the greatest shooting backcourt in NBA history. Their ability to hit shots from anywhere on the court changed the geometry of the game, forcing defenses to stretch and adapt.
- The 2015 Championship: The Warriors' first title in 40 years, signaling the arrival of a new dynasty.
- The 73-9 Season (2016): Breaking the Chicago Bulls' record for the best regular-season record ever.
- Kevin Durant Era: The addition of Kevin Durant solidified the Warriors' dominance, leading to back-to-back championships in 2017 and 2018. Even though his time was short, Durant's impact was undeniable, adding another layer of offensive firepower.
- Recent Rebuild and Return to Glory: Navigating injuries, roster changes, and a brief dip in the standings, the Warriors bounced back to win the 2022 championship, proving their resilience and championship DNA.
The Stars That Shine Brightest
The Warriors' success is built on a foundation of incredible talent. Here are some of the key players who have defined the team's journey:
- Stephen Curry: Arguably the greatest shooter of all time, Steph's impact on and off the court is immeasurable. His gravity warps defenses, creating opportunities for his teammates, and his infectious personality makes him a beloved figure in the Bay Area and worldwide. He's not just a scorer; he's a playmaker, a leader, and an inspiration.
- Klay Thompson: One half of the Splash Brothers, Klay's sharpshooting and defensive prowess make him an indispensable part of the Warriors' core. His ability to get hot in an instant and his stoic demeanor make him a fan favorite. The Warriors are simply not the same team without Klay's presence on the court.
- Draymond Green: The heart and soul of the Warriors, Draymond's defensive versatility, playmaking, and vocal leadership are essential to the team's identity. He's the ultimate glue guy, doing all the little things that don't show up in the box score but contribute to winning basketball. His passion and intensity are contagious, setting the tone for the entire team.
- Steve Kerr: The coach who brought it all together. Kerr's emphasis on ball movement, player development, and a positive team culture has been instrumental in the Warriors' success. His calm demeanor and strategic mind have guided the team through countless challenges, making him one of the most respected coaches in the league.

Key Stats to Follow
To truly understand the Warriors' performance, keep an eye on these key stats:
- Points Per Game (PPG): A basic measure of offensive output.
- Three-Point Percentage: A critical indicator of the Warriors' shooting efficiency.
- Assists Per Game (APG): Reflects the team's ball movement and unselfish play.
- Defensive Rating: Measures the team's defensive efficiency, indicating how well they prevent opponents from scoring.
